Piperonyl acetone
- CAS NO.:55418-52-5
- Empirical Formula: C11H12O3
- Molecular Weight: 192.21
- MDL number: MFCD00016910
- EINECS: 259-630-1

What is Piperonyl acetone?
Description
4-(3,4-Methylenedioxyphenyl)-2-butanone has an intensely sweet, floral, slightly woody odor. May be prepared by condensation of heliotropin with acetone, followed by hydrogenation in the presence of a palladium catalyst.
Chemical properties
4-(3,4-Methylenedioxyphenyl)-2-butanone has an intensely sweet, floral, slightly woody odor reminiscent of raspberry, cotton candy (i.e., candy floss) with a cassie, heliotrope association.
Occurrence
Has apparently not been reported to occur in nature.
Preparation
By condensation of heliotropin with acetone, followed by hydrogenation in the presence of a palladium catalyst
Definition
ChEBI: 4-(3,4-Methylenedioxyphenyl)-2-butanone is a member of benzodioxoles.
Taste threshold values
Taste characteristics at 40 ppm: sweet, berry-like with spicy, jamy nuances
Metabolism
The oxygen-aromatic carbon link of aromatic ethers is generally biologically stable, and possible metabolites include the p-hydroxy derivative of the ether, the phenol or the p-hydroxyphenol (Williams, 1959). Ketones are not readily metabolized in the body. As a derivative of 2-butanone, piperonyl acetone might be expected to be partially reduced to the secondary alcohol and excreted as the glucuronide (Williams, 1959), since Saneyoshi (1911) isolated the glucuronide of 2-butanol from the urine of rabbits receiving methyl ethyl ketone.
Properties of Piperonyl acetone
| Melting point: | 49-54 °C(lit.) |
| Boiling point: | 176 °C17 mm Hg(lit.) |
| Density | 1.175±0.06 g/cm3(Predicted) |
| refractive index | 1.52-1.522 |
| FEMA | 2701 | 4-(3,4-METHYLENEDIOXYPHENYL)-2-BUTANONE |
| Flash point: | >230 °F |
| storage temp. | 4°C |
| solubility | Chloroform (Slightly), DMSO (Slightly) |
| form | Solid |
| color | Colourless crystals. |
| Odor | at 10.00 % in dipropylene glycol. sweet raspberry heliotrope powdery cotton candy |
| JECFA Number | 2048 |
